The Hanover County Emergency Communications Team is recruiting for new team members. Our team of dedicated communications officers serve as the first line of communication for community members in need. We are the link between the citizens and the public safety community. We dispatch Sheriff, Fire/EMS, and Animal Control to provide aide in both emergency and non-emergency situations.

Qualified candidates who apply online will be contacted directly to schedule an orientation/informational session, at which time applicants will be given the option of either an in-person testing time or will be sent information to complete the CRITICALL testing online.

After successful completion of the CRITICALL test, selected candidates will be required to complete an online Assessment; attend an panel interview session; and complete a full background investigation conducted by the Hanover Sheriff's Office.

General Description: This is a technical position. The incumbent performs complex tasks in the operation of the County 911 system.

Organization: The Emergency Communications Officer position is part of Hanover County's Career Development Program (CD). The Emergency Communications Officer Ladder has four levels ranging from Emergency Communications Officer First Class to Emergency Communications Officer - Career. Incumbents report to an Emergency Communications Supervisor and supervise no staff. However, Senior Emergency Communications Officers - Master and Career may serve as workflow leaders to lower-level Officers.

 Essential Functions:

· Answers emergency and service-related calls.

· Monitors alarms, security systems and radio traffic, responding as needed.

· Operates radio consoles, prioritizing and dispatching calls for service.

· Enters emergency and service-related data into the Computer Aided
   Dispatch (CAD) System.

· Tracks unit activity in the CAD System.

· Operates VCIN/NCIC terminals.

· Researches computerized data and information.

· Plays back digital recordings.

· Completes logs and other documentation related to 911 activities.

· Perform related work as assigned

Working Conditions:

A. Hazard

· Customers – Contact with customers in difficult situations

· Conditions – Noisy and stressful work environment

B. Environment

· Office

C. Physical Effort

· Boxes of Paper – May be able to lift up to twenty (20) pounds

D. Non-exempt

Knowledge, Skills and Abilities: Must be able to read, hear and speak the English language. Must be able to perform multiple tasks concurrently. Ability to communicate with callers using a TDD, desired. Ability to monitor traffic and handle messages over the North Anna Insta-phone Network, desired. Knowledge of the geographical layout of Hanover County and the ability to read maps and to provide directions, preferred. Ability to analyze situations and react swiftly and rationally in high stress situations. 

Education, Experience and Training: High school diploma or equivalent, required. Higher levels on the Career Ladder require experience and additional training. Related experience desired as follows: 1 year @ First Class level, 2-3 years @ Senior level, and 3-5 years Master level. Any equivalent combination of education, experience and/or training sufficient to demonstrate the knowledge, skills and abilities is acceptable.

Special Conditions:

· Must be at least eighteen (18) years old

· U. S. Citizen

· Complete Criminal Background Investigation

· Twelve-month probationary period

· Work beyond normal work schedule

· Shift Work, including weekends, holidays and nights

· Pre-employment Physical Examination/Drug Test/Audiometric and
   repeated regularly thereafter

· Pre-employment CRITICALL Test

· Essential staff designation

· Must wear uniform
